Bally Hooley Station

Bally Hooley Station offers a nostalgic journey on a heritage steam train, running 4km between Port Douglas and Craiglie, echoing the region's historic sugar cane trains.

Ngarru Art Gallery

Ngarru Art Gallery in Port Douglas showcases diverse Indigenous art, including paintings, sculptures, textiles, and jewelry by local artists.

Palmer Sea Reef Golf and Country Club

Palmer Sea Reef Golf & Country Club, designed by Greg Norman, ranks among Australia's premier championship courses.

Saint Marys by the Sea

St. Mary's by the Sea, a historic church in Port Douglas, QLD, overlooks the Coral Sea. Popular for weddings and worship
